AISI 1071 Composition

Element Content (%)
Iron, Fe ~ 98
Carbon, C 0.65 – 0.75
Manganese, Mn 0.60 – 0.90
Sulfur, S 0.050 (max)
Phosphorous, P 0.04 (max)

AISI 1071 Physical Properties

Properties Metric Imperial
Density 7.7-8.03 g/cm3 0.278-0.290 lb/in³

AISI 1071 Mechanical Properties

Properties Metric Imperial
Elastic modulus 190-210 GPa 29700-30458 ksi
Poisson’s ratio 0.27-0.30 0.27-0.30

AISI 1071 Uses

SAE / AISI 1071 is a high-carbon steel that can be used in a variety of applications. It is often used to create shafts, gears, and other parts that need to withstand high levels of wear and tear. This steel can also be used to create cutting tools, as it is able to retain its edge well.
